Title: The Innovations of Matthew Lewinski
Introduction
Matthew Lewinski is an accomplished inventor based in San Francisco, CA. He has made significant contributions to the field of IT automation, holding a total of four patents. His work focuses on enhancing the efficiency and effectiveness of imaging systems for managed endpoints.
Latest Patents
One of Matthew's latest patents is an IT automation appliance imaging system and method. This innovative system provides a method and computer program product for harvesting an image from a local disk of a managed endpoint to an image library. In this method, a managed endpoint is equipped with a boot image that instantiates a RAM disk and executes the boot image from that RAM disk. The boot image is utilized to harvest an image by identifying data on the local disk that should be included in the image but is not already stored in the image library. This process involves comparing hashes calculated on the local disk data to those of the data in the image library. Any data not already stored in the image library is then copied over, ensuring that the image library remains up-to-date.
